Lets hope they have enuf sense to get out of the rain, however, if they are not aware of a "new" house (temporary accomodation with roof) then dont depend on them finding it. you can make a smaller temporary roofed sleeping place INSIDE the place they are used to sleeping at nite... have a kiddy tent or something you can put up in there?

you can always stick some storage boxes with covers in their run for now just put a hole for them to get in. Herd a couple into the box to show them where it is and the others will follow.
I have pine shavings in mine and this is what we are doing till their coop is finished.
We had tarps to but the water just got in anyway.So we put the covers on the boxes and now they are nice and dry.
